Prevent mosquito bites when traveling overseas
.png?ixlib=rb-1.1.0&w=2000&h=2000&fit=max&or=0&s=0d131b76a21526992e982b034f1c8f90)
- Choose a hotel or lodging with air conditioning or screens on windows and doors.
- Sleep under a mosquito bed net.
- Choose a World Health Organization Pesticide Evaluation Scheme (WHOPES) approved bed net: compact, white, rectangular, with 156 holes per square inch, and long enough to tuck under the mattress.
- Permethrin-treated bed nets provide more protection than untreated nets.
- Do not wash bed nets or expose them to sunlight. This will break down the insecticide more quickly
